<p>WHISPERS FROM THE DARK</p><p><br></p><p>The Door That Didn't Exist: The Disappearance of Brian Shaffer</p><p>Host: Raven Vale | Fuzzy Life Studios</p><p><br></p><p>On the night of April 1st, 2006, a 27-year-old Ohio State medical student named Brian Shaffer walked into a bar in Columbus, Ohio.</p><p>A security camera captured him at the entrance. He paused. He smiled at two women nearby. He walked through the door.</p><p>He was never seen again.</p><p>Every other person who entered the Ugly Tuna Saloona that night was captured...

<p>WHISPERS FROM THE DARK</p><p><br></p><p>Episode: The Last Call in the Dark: What Happened to Brandon Lawson?</p><p>Host: Raven Vale | Fuzzy Life Studios</p><p><br></p><p>On the night of August 8th, 2013, a 26-year-old man named Brandon Lawson left his home in San Angelo, Texas after an argument. His truck ran out of gas on Highway 277 near Bronte. He called his brother for help.</p><p>And then he called 911.</p><p>The call lasted one minute and forty-nine seconds. In it, Brandon described being chased into the woods, men pursuing...
